King Charles Celebrates 75th Birthday with Gun Salutes and Food Waste Project

King Charles marked his 75th birthday with grandeur, featuring gun salutes, a birthday sing-along at a food waste project, and an NHS reception.

Amidst the festivities, an unexpected phone call from son Prince Harry added a dynamic twist to the celebrations.

Celebrations and Public Engagement:

King Charles, accompanied by Queen Camilla, launched the Coronation Food Project in Didcot, Oxfordshire.

The monarch engaged with the community, symbolically purchasing a Big Issue magazine and participating in a birthday sing-along.

The Coronation Food Project aims to address food waste and the cost of living crisis.

Food Project Details and King’s Involvement:

The Coronation Food Project, inspired by King Charles, collaborates with existing initiatives to reduce food waste.

Led by Baroness Casey and Dame Martina Milburn, the project aims to raise funds, build warehouses, and support nationwide efforts to utilize surplus food for social good.

Upcoming Celebrations and NHS Reception:

Later in the day, King Charles is set to host a Buckingham Palace reception, highlighting the contributions of nurses and midwives as part of the NHS 75 celebrations.

The event will bring together healthcare professionals and dignitaries to honor their dedication over the decades.
